Ms. Wiggins received a BA in Education from the University of North Carolina/Chapel Hill in 1979, and taught in the North Carolina public school system for eight years before joining the Semiconductor Research Corporation in 1988. Pursuing her interest in K-12 education, Ms. Wiggins was instrumental in the development of the VISION Program for middle and high school science and mathematics teachers, implemented through the SRC Education Alliance between 1989 and 1993. Ms. Wiggins has extensive experience in developing and managing programs that bridge between SRC-supported students and SRC member companies including Web distribution of student information and technical conferences. She has managed SRC’s student programs, including the Graduate Fellowship, Master’s Scholarship and Undergraduate Research Assistants Programs, since 1993 when the department was created. She currently has oversight for the SRC, SRCEA, and MARCO student programs which serve over 1,000 students at 104 universities worldwide |
